Abstract

A fault diagnosis unit () of a fault diagnosis apparatus () performs a fault diagnosis of a communication network () with a probabilistic inference algorithm using information on the communication network () having been gathered by an NW monitoring unit (). A diagnosis result determining unit () determines test items for confirming and determining a diagnosis result of the fault diagnosis. A test performing unit () performs a confirmation test of the determined test items. The diagnosis result determining unit () determines a likelihood of the diagnosis result of the fault diagnosis based on a result of the confirmation test.
